They were used in ancient Rome to count and record numbers. While they may seem cryptic to us today, Roman numerals were a crucial part of ancient mathematical notation. In a Roman numeral system, each letter or symbol corresponds to a specific integer value. For example, the numeral I is equivalent to 1, V is equal to 5, and so on.
